الانتقال إلى المحتوى
View in the app

A better way to browse. Learn more.

مجموعة مستخدمي أوراكل العربية

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

لدى مشكلة فى Sql Plus

Featured Replies

بتاريخ:

السلام عليكم
لدى مشكلة وهى انة بعد تنصيب اوراكل 10g وعند استخدام Sql Plus والدخول بمستخدم system والباسورد الذى قمت بأنشاءة
والدخول وعند تنفيذ امر مثل
Select * from dept;
يظهر رسالة
ERROR at line 1:
ORA-00942: table or view does not exist
وقد قمت بتغير نسخة الويندوز 3 مرات وتغير نسخة الاوراكل مرتين ونفس المشكلة

ارجوا المساعدة
شكرا

بتاريخ:

Select * from dept;
يظهر رسالة
ERROR at line 1:
ORA-00942: table or view does not exist

==================================================

اولا : متكتبش الاستعلام كله على سطر واحد مش صح خصوصا فى الاوراكل

ثانيا: الرساله ديه (table or view does not exist) معناهابيقولك ان الاسم الى انت كتبه غلط وده ملوش علاقه خالص لا بنسخه الاوراكل ولا بنسخه الويندوز ده عيب فيك انت ياعنى كلمة dept ديه غلط ................

ثالثا : جرب الاستعلام ده على المستخدم scott /tiger

sql > select *
from emp;

====================== أو

sql > select *
from tab;
==============================
ملحوظه : جدول ال emplooy ده معملوا أسم مرادف الى هو emp . فا مش شرط يكون جدول القسم هو كمان يكون معملوا اسم مرادف زيه وعادة ده بيبقى على طول جاهز بس لجدول الوظف بس القسم لا ....... وشكراااا وحاول تترجم الرسائل الى بتطلعلك

أرجوا نك تكون فهمت ( احمد مبرمج قواعد بيانات أوراكل )

تم تعديل بواسطة developer 10g

بتاريخ:

Select * from dept;
يظهر رسالة
ERROR at line 1:
ORA-00942: table or view does not exist

==================================================


الرساله ديه (table or view does not exist) معناهابيقولك ان الاسم الى انت كتبه غلط وده ملوش علاقه خالص لا بنسخه الاوراكل ولا بنسخه الويندوز ده عيب فيك انت ياعنى كلمة dept ديه ممكن ميكنش الجدول موجدود او موجود بس مش بالاسم ده

جرب الاستعلام ده على المستخدم scott /tiger وكمان جرب استعلامك على المستخدم ده وشوف النتيجه وخير ان شاء الله

sql > select *
from emp;

====================== أو

sql > select *
from tab;
==============================
ملحوظه : جدول ال emplooy ده معملوا أسم مرادف الى هو emp . فا مش شرط يكون جدول القسم هو كمان يكون معملوا اسم مرادف زيه وعادة ده بيبقى على طول جاهز بس لجدول الوظف بس القسم لا ....... وشكراااا وحاول تترجم الرسائل الى بتطلعلك

أرجوا نك تكون فهمت ( احمد مبرمج قواعد بيانات أوراكل )
بتاريخ:

Select * from dept;
يظهر رسالة
ERROR at line 1:
ORA-00942: table or view does not exist

==================================================
أولا / بالنسبه لموضوع الاستعلام على سطر واحد صح تمام بس هو بنفضل ننظم طريقة كتابة الاستعلام على خطوات متتاليه وده علشان يحددبالظبط فين مكان الجمله الغلط او الكلمة الغلط وده الاصح .

ثانيا: الرساله ديه (table or view does not exist) معناهابيقولك ان الاسم الى انت كتبه( غلط او مش موجود) وده ملوش علاقه خالص لا بنسخه الاوراكل ولا بنسخه الويندوز استعلم عن الجداول الى فى قاعدة بياناتك وشوف هو مكتوب ازاى ولا هو موجود ولا لا اصلا
====================================================
SQL> select * from dept;

DEPTNO DNAME LOC
---------- -------------- -------------
10 ACCOUNTING NEW YORK
20 RESEARCH DALLAS
30 SALES CHICAGO
40 OPERATIONS BOSTON
===================================================
ديه نتيجه استعلامك على المستخدم scottL tiger

ثالثا : جرب الاستعلام ده على المستخدم scott /tiger

sql > select *
from emp;

====================== و علشان تعرف الجداول الى موجوده عندك واساميها الصح

sql > select *
from tab;
==============================
ملحوظه : جدول ال emplooy ده معملوا أسم مرادف الى هو emp . وشكراااا وحاول تترجم الرسائل الى بتطلعلك

أرجوا نك تكون فهمت ( احمد مبرمج قواعد بيانات أوراكل )
بتاريخ:

اسف لتكرار الرد وده لسبب مشكله عندىة فى النت خلتى اتلخبط وكتبت غلط معلش الرد الاخير هو الاصلح ربنا معاك اسف مرة تانيه على تكرار الرد لوجود مشكله بس الحمد لله اتحلت

بتاريخ:
  • كاتب الموضوع

شكرا اخى احمد وفعلا قمت بتشغيل المستخدم scott وذالك من خلال الامر alter user scott account unlock;
من خلال isql plus من خلال الرابط http://localhost:5561/isqlplus وبعدها قمت بالدخول من خلال sql plus وقمت بالتجربة ونحج الامر شكرا
ولكن اريد ان اعرف لماذا لا يتم عرض هذة الجداول من خلال المستخدم system
مع العلم انا مبتدى فبماذا تنصحنى بالبداية لدى خمس اسطوانات لتعليم الاوراكل فهل اتبعهم ام يوجد دروس افضل
شكرا

بتاريخ:

الاخ العزيز
احب أوضح لك شئ من عوامل السرية في الاوراكل الا يرى مستخدم جداول المستخدم الاخر الا اذا سمح له بذلك

و لهذا لا يستطيع المستخدم system رؤية الجدول المذكور لانه من جداول المستخدم scott

انضم إلى المناقشة

ي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.

زائر
أضف رد على هذا الموضوع...

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ية

Account

Navigation

البحث

إعداد إشعارات المتصفح الفورية

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.